Tory Island

Directions:
To get to Tory Island, head for Letterkenny. Then take the N56 signposted Creeslough. Just after the village of Gortahork, on a bend turning to your left, take a right turn - clearly signposted Magheroarty (or, as you are now in the Gaeltach, Machaire Ui Rabhartaigh). After approx 2 miles, you get to Magheroarty - then take a right turn, marked Pier/Harbour. At the harbour there is a large car park. Leave your car here and take the ferry (approx 30 - 45 minutes).

There is also a ferry (a longer ferry trip) from Bunbeg, further round the coast. However Magheroarty is recommended.

Parking:
As you can't take your car to Tory Island, parking isn't a problem!

 

Facilities:
Tory has an hotel, a shop (limited opening hours) a club and a fish and chip shop. Other accommodation is available. Pat Doohan (who runs the hotel) also runs the dive shop (compressor to fill tanks) and RIBs to take you to dive sites.

Why we like Tory Island:
As Tory Island is 10 miles off the coast, the water is usually crystal clear. We have done a number of fantastic dives on the west side of Tormore.

Depths in this area up to 25m
